MS's Language Arts assignment a couple of weeks ago was to state a problem and develop an invention that solved the problem. The second week, he was to do a brain- or cluster-map, which was a free-flow of his ideas with words and/or drawings related to his invention/solution. He then wrote out his solution from the prewriting.

Here’s the problem: to clean a room takes a really long time. The solution is to build a good robot that can clean rooms. If everything goes well, I’ll have a robot that gets more work accomplished and does the job in half the time a person can!

Of course, there are cons to this dream machine too: people will lose jobs and get less exercise (Although, the robot could remind people to exercise, and people could get jobs fixing the robot
The robot can do so much more than cleaning rooms, though. If it works well, the robot can work in garages, fix things; clean other places, just about anything!

My plan for the robot is that wires take information from the programming disk inserted to command central to different parts of the robot.

The outside will be lightweight and durable, and a “Job Done” light will flash when the job is completed. The robot also has small wheels on its feet that let it scoot quickly around the work area. The grabbers on its hands let it grip any kind of tool. Rubber on the robots arms and neck allows it to stretch.

All in all, the robot is a highly advanced and useful machine that, if invented, will help many people, and could be useful now and in the future.
